#032e54 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#032e54 is composed of 1.2% red, 18%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.4% cyan, 45.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 67.1% black. It has a hue angle of 208.1 degrees, a saturation of 93.1% and a lightness of 17.1%. #032e54 color hex could be obtained by blending #065ca8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

● #032e54 color description : Very dark blue.
The hexadecimal color #032e54 has RGB values of R:3, G:46,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0.96, M:0.45, Y:0,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 208468.
